Amid debate over a corporate wealth tax in Colombia, analysis shows only three OECD countries impose a general net personal wealth tax. Other European nations tax specific assets, while in the region, Argentina and Uruguay have similar levies. Experts warn such taxes are falling out of use and could harm competitiveness.

The Economist magazine ranked Colombia fourth among 36 OECD economies with the best performance in 2025, tying with Spain. This recognition highlights the country's strong economic growth and thriving stock market. President Gustavo Petro celebrated the achievement, crediting it with attracting global investors.
